  • AIR SDK vs. AIR Runtime (from the download page)

    On the AIR 2 Beta download pag, I'm not sure what's the difference between the AIR SDK and  the AIR Runtime.
    http://labs.adobe.com/downloads/air2.html
    Do I need to download both? I know I need the AIR SDK to add it to my Flex SDK in Eclipse, but what's the Runtime and do I need to download that?

    AIR SDK is for developers. So if you want to create an application using Flash Builder, you need to download that SDK and overlay it in your FB.
    AIR Runtime is for end users. If somebody wants to use an AIR application, he/she first needs to download and install AIR Runtime (and then the AIR application can be installed).
    Hope that clarifies.
